Foothills Golf Club
About
Foothills Golf Club offers 18 holes of golf on a golf course designed by Jay Morrish and Tom Weiskopf and built in 1988. The par-72 golf course measures 6,901 yards. Foothills Golf Club sits among the South Mountains, and features a contrast of challenge and forgiveness on a links-style course that allows golfers to play a target layout that has more than 65 bunkers that daunt, fairways that roll and desert that has a lot of rocks. The fabulous championship golf course provides the locale for all levels of golfer to shoot a memorable day of golf.
After taking in the views of the South Mountains on the Foothills Golf Club's golf course, head back to the clubhouse, for wonderful vistas of the course and the Estrella Mountain Range.
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Championship | 72 | 6901 yards | 72.7 | 130 |
| Back | 72 | 6405 yards | 70.0 | 121 |
| Middle | 72 | 6035 yards | 68.1 | 116 |
| Middle (W) | 72 | 6035 yards | 74.0 | 130 |
| Forward (W) | 72 | 5441 yards | 70.1 | 117 |
| Forward | 72 | 5441 yards | 65.3 | 108 |

No cars available
Red course in great shape. Fairways easy to hit from and greens slower than normal. Will play course again.
However, our foursome was not allowed to get a cart for a disabled person who wanted to ride with his son. We were told there were no carts available- even though we saw several waiting by the starter on the red course ( even though we offered to pay). Thought this policy is very poor and does not represent fair treatment for disabled people). We were required to take turns walking a hole at a time or standing on the back of a cart). This was extremely hard getting to the red course from the clubhouse.
In addition, we saw no detour signs to the course due to road construction- poor.
Given all the above, we still enjoyed playing the course and recommend this course. Improvements in directions and policy would make it even better.
Course is in good shape
The course is in good condition. Tee boxes could use a little TLC; fairways were good; sand traps could use a little more sand; first-cut rough was OK, whereas balance was sparse in places; greens were firm and lush, however they were very slow. Pace was good (3:50), as was value. Combine all that with a beautiful spring day and it was a very good day, indeed.

Cold and misty but worth it!
Greens: very consistent. Pretty good shape but we’re slow due to dampness. A few bare spots. Pin location was fair.
Fairways: in very good shape but a few areas that were bare. Couple of area with ground under repair. If you were in the fairway, you were rewarded with a good lie. First cut of rough was nice and green too. Rest of rough was full of weeds and hard to swing through.
Staff: friendly and welcoming
Pace of play: Fantastic due to rain. If was cold so there were very few people on the course.
I would recommend this course.!
